#!/bin/bash | ||
set -ex | ||
# test script to run GSI to UFO sat bias converter and produce files | ||
srcdir=$1 | ||
builddir=$2 | ||
|
||
# stage a testrun directory for this test | ||
testrun=$builddir/test/testrun/satbias_conv | ||
mkdir -p $testrun | ||
|
||
# copy GSI input files | ||
# the converter assumes a directory structure like we have for GDAS/GFS | ||
mkdir -p $testrun/input/gdas.20220401/00/atmos | ||
|
||
cp $builddir/test/testdata/gdas.t00z.abias* $testrun/input/gdas.20220401/00/atmos/. | ||
|
||
# create the YAML file as input | ||
cat > $builddir/test/testinput/run_satbias_conv.yaml << EOF | ||
start time: 2022-04-01T00:00:00Z | ||
end time: 2022-04-01T00:00:00Z | ||
assim_freq: 6 | ||
dump: gdas | ||
gsi_bc_root: $testrun/input | ||
ufo_bc_root: $testrun/out | ||
work_root: $testrun/work | ||
satbias2ioda: $builddir/bin/satbias2ioda.x | ||
EOF | ||
|
||
# run the script | ||
python3 $srcdir/ush/run_satbias_conv.py --config $builddir/test/testinput/run_satbias_conv.yaml | ||
|
||
# copy output to testoutput | ||
testout=$builddir/test/testoutput | ||
mkdir -p $testout/satbias | ||
cp -rf $testrun/out/* $testout/satbias/. | ||
|
||
# clean up run directory | ||
rm -rf $testrun |

@@ -0,0 +1,48 @@ | ||
import r2d2 | ||
from solo.configuration import Configuration | ||
from solo.date import date_sequence, Hour | ||
|
||
|
||
def store(config): | ||
times = date_sequence(config.start, config.end, config.step) | ||
obs_types = config.obs_types | ||
provider = config.provider | ||
experiment = config.experiment | ||
database = config.database | ||
type = config.type | ||
file_type = config.get('file_type', None) | ||
source_dir = config.source_dir | ||
source_file_fmt = config.source_file_fmt | ||
step = config.step | ||
dump = config.get('dump', 'gdas') | ||
|
||
for time in times: | ||
year = Hour(time).format('%Y') | ||
month = Hour(time).format('%m') | ||
day = Hour(time).format('%d') | ||
hour = Hour(time).format('%H') | ||
for obs_type in obs_types: | ||
if type == 'bc': | ||
r2d2.store( | ||
provider=provider, | ||
type=type, | ||
file_type=file_type, | ||
experiment=experiment, | ||
database=database, | ||
date=time, | ||
obs_type=obs_type, | ||
source_file=eval(f"f'{source_file_fmt}'"), | ||
ignore_missing=True, | ||
) | ||
else: | ||
r2d2.store( | ||
provider=provider, | ||
type=type, | ||
experiment=experiment, | ||
database=database, | ||
date=time, | ||
obs_type=obs_type, | ||
time_window=step, | ||
source_file=eval(f"f'{source_file_fmt}'"), | ||
ignore_missing=True, | ||
) |
